For implementation of Automated Driving Test System at RTO centers
Cerebra Integrated Technologies announced that the Office of the Commissioner for Transport and Road Safety, Transport Department, Government of Karnataka has finalised a project to automate the process of conducting driving tests and the issuance of licences at select RTO centers across the state through a contract signed with the Company.The Automated Driving Test System (ADTS) is an endeavour by Karnataka Transport Department to standardise and automate the procedure of evaluating the driving skills of a person before granting him license.
The total value of the solution including software, servers and other related hardware etc is estimated to Rs 21.6 crore including five years contract to implement, run and maintain.
